How to Actually Withdraw Your Free Bonus Winnings

This is where most people fail. You win £50 from a free bingo bonus. Great. But you cannot just click withdraw. You need to follow a specific process.

  1. Meet the wagering first. Usually 30x to 40x on the bonus amount. Not the winnings. That is a common trap.
  2. Deposit once. Most UKGC sites require a minimum deposit (often £10) before you can withdraw any winnings from a no deposit bonus. Annoying, but legal.
  3. Verify your ID. Have your passport or driving license ready. They ask for it before the first payout.
  4. Choose the right method. PayPal or Skrill are fastest. Bank transfers can take days.

Comparing Wagering Requirements Across Brands

Wagering requirements are the hidden cost of any bonus. A 40x rollover on a £10 bonus means you need to bet £400 before withdrawing. Some sites bury these terms in small print. The Hidden Cost of Max-Bet Rules

Max-bet restrictions are another trap. When a bonus is active, many sites limit stakes to £2 or £5 per spin. Party Casino enforces a £2 max bet. That is fine for penny slots, but it kills the pace if you prefer higher volatility games. PlayOJO avoids this entirely by offering wager-free spins with no restrictions.
